What Are Male Plug Components? An Overview

The term male plug typically refers to a type of connector or fitting that features a threaded or smooth male end designed to insert into a corresponding female component. These plugs are versatile and are crafted from durable materials such as brass, stainless steel, or alloys to withstand harsh operational environments.

In essence, male plugs are used to close off, connect, or seal pipes, tubes, or valves, providing a reliable interface. The standard design includes a tapered or threaded section that facilitates secure mating with female counterparts, ensuring minimal leakage and maximum integrity.

Material Choices and Their Impact on Male Plug Uses

The selection of male plugs material significantly influences their application and performance:

  • Brass: Widely used in plumbing and pneumatic applications due to its corrosion resistance and machinability.
  • Stainless Steel: Ideal for chemical, high-pressure, or high-temperature systems due to its strength and corrosion resistance.
  • Plastic: Suitable for low-pressure, non-corrosive environments; cost-effective for temporary installation.

Installation Best Practices for Male Plugs

To maximize the efficiency and longevity of male plugs, adhere to these best practices:

  1. Ensure compatibility of thread sizes and types between the male plug and female fittings.
  2. Apply appropriate sealants or thread tapes to prevent leaks, especially in high-pressure systems.
  3. Use proper torque specifications to avoid over-tightening, which can damage threads or deform components.
  4. Inspect plugs regularly for signs of wear, corrosion, or damage, replacing as necessary.
  5. Maintain cleanliness during installation to prevent debris from compromising seals or connections.
